Highlights

01:25 — After successfully working from home for two years, it seems unlikely that many people will want to physically return to the office.

01:45 — Additionally, as companies have opened options for a hybrid workweek (coming in 2 or 3 days a week), how do you ensure there is an overlap? For instance, if some employees come in on Monday-Tuesday and others come in on Thursday-Friday, what’s the point of coming in?

02:10 — Dr. Nick Bloom and a team from Stanford University have been conducting research involving work-from-home and work-from-anywhere.

02:25 — Cornell University published a paper titled The Emerging Spectrum of Flexible Work Locations: Implications for Travel Demand and Carbon Emissions. The paper discusses how the work-from-home becomes the work-from-anywhere and the shift in commutes as well as a change in patterns of sustainability.

03:00 — Wayne proposes advice to Howard Shultz, CEO of Starbucks. Shultz’s original ‘third place’ idea was that we could have a place that isn’t home, the office, or school to get work done, mingle, and more.

03:35 — The advice Wayne shares for Shultz is to upgrade the ‘third place’ concept of Starbucks by providing spaces with Wi-Fi and a great atmosphere as well as food and coffee to build a temporary, rentable work environment.

Wayne Sadin, a Cloud Wars analyst focused on board strategy, has had a 30-year IT career spanning logistics, financial services, energy, healthcare, manufacturing, direct-response marketing, construction, consulting, and technology. He’s been CIO, CTO, CDO, an advisor to CEOs and boards, Angel Investor, and independent director at firms ranging from start-ups to multinationals.
